What Is an Air Insulated Busway?

An Air Insulated Busway (AIB) is a type of electrical Power Distribution System that uses air as the primary insulation medium between conductors.

The system typically consists of:

Aluminum or copper conductors

Metal enclosure

Insulating supports

Joint connections

Protective housing

Unlike Sandwich Busway systems where conductors are tightly packed with insulation materials, air insulated busways maintain air gaps between conductors for heat dissipation and insulation performance.

Air insulated busway systems are commonly used for current ratings from 400A to 6300A and are suitable for long-distance power transmission in industrial and commercial applications.

Advantages of Air Insulated Busway Systems

01 Excellent Heat Dissipation

One of the biggest advantages of air insulated busway systems is their superior cooling performance. The air gaps between conductors allow natural ventilation, helping reduce operating temperatures.

Especially suitable for:

Industrial plants

Manufacturing facilities

Heavy electrical loads

Large infrastructure projects

02 Easy Maintenance and Inspection

Air insulated busways are designed with accessible internal structures, making maintenance and inspection easier compared to compact sandwich busways.

Benefits include:

Faster troubleshooting

Simplified inspection

Reduced maintenance downtime

Convenient conductor replacement

03 Flexible Installation

Air insulated busway systems support:

Horizontal installation

Vertical risers

Long-distance transmission

Complex routing layouts

04 High Safety Performance

Modern air insulated busway systems are manufactured according to IEC and international safety standards.

Flame-retardant enclosure

Short-circuit resistance

High mechanical strength

Reliable grounding protection

Air Insulated Busway vs Sandwich Busway

Both systems are widely used in power distribution projects, but they serve different needs.

Air Insulated Busway

Better heat dissipation

Easier maintenance

Suitable for long-distance transmission

Larger installation space required

Sandwich Busway

Compact structure

Space-saving design

Higher protection level

Commonly used in high-rise buildings

Choosing the right system depends on:

Installation environment

Current capacity

Available space

Maintenance requirements

Project budget

How to Choose the Right Air Insulated Busway

When selecting an air insulated busway system, consider the following factors:

Current Rating: Choose the correct ampere range based on project load requirements.

Conductor Material: Copper conductors provide higher conductivity, while aluminum offers cost advantages.

Protection Level: Select suitable IP ratings for indoor or outdoor installation environments.

Project Layout: Evaluate routing distance, installation direction, and expansion requirements.

Compliance Standards: Ensure the system meets IEC, ISO, and local electrical standards.
